Statham's clay-heavy soil is honestly one of the biggest reasons artificial turf makes sense here. That dense Barrow County clay doesn't drain the way sandy soils do, which means natural grass battles standing water in spring and becomes hard-packed and bare by midsummer. Artificial turf eliminates all of that. We build in proper drainage layers during installation so water moves through the system instead of pooling on your property. Most yards in the Statham area range from quarter-acre to a couple acres, which gives plenty of room for a quality turf installation that really pays off. Sun exposure varies—some properties back up to tree lines, others get full southern exposure. We assess your specific yard during the site visit to recommend the right turf pile height and density for your situation. The heat here in July and August is real, so we use turf designed to stay cooler underfoot and resist UV degradation over years of intense sun. Installation typically happens over 2–3 days depending on yard size and how much prep work the clay soil needs.
